Popgurls.com did 20 questions with Sarah Dessen, the author of ‘How to Deal’, including several about the film adaption and its star, Mandy Moore. Asked if she had any preconceived notions of what she would be like in person, Dessen responded, “I had no idea what to expect. It’s funny how celebrities always seem smaller in person, but she was just the opposite: she’s REALLY tall. And I thought she’d act more like my students at UNC (University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ill) who are about that age, 18-19, but she was so serious and professional. I was really just concentrating on not acting like a total dork. I was so nervous I can’t even remember what I said to her.” Read more.
